Output a596c54738670f706117b60618998b71ab52cb50453568a246544de9cbe09c77:62

value
14911357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 842f40ffa4738dd856b028455b477fe2bd78659d OP_EQUAL
address
3Djwj89EuN65Nhn1uoW9cWRukdVTpbaD5Z
transaction
a596c54738670f706117b60618998b71ab52cb50453568a246544de9cbe09c77
spent
true